What are the phase change processes taking place when a substance is in equilibrium between liquid and gas phases? A. Melting and boiling B. Expanding and contracting C. Evaporating and condensing D. Freezing and thawing

Answers

Answer:  C. Evaporating and condensing

Explanation:  Phase change process id the process in which the phase of one substance is transforming into the another.

These chemical process of transformation can takes place under dynamic equilibrium in which conversion of one phase is in equilibrium with the another one.

In this liquid phase is transforming into the gas phase which is known as Evaporation and gaseous phase is converting back into the liquid phase which is known as Condensation.

C. Evaporating and condensing. When the liquid becomes gas is called evaporation. When gas become liquid it's condensation.

What is the freezing point of lead

Answers

The freezing point of lead is 621.5 fahrenheit (327.5 celsius). The freezing point is the temperature at which a substance transitions from its liquid to its solid state, typically under normal atmospheric pressure.

The temperature at which a substance changes from its liquid phase to a solid phase, normally under normal atmospheric pressure, is referred to as the freezing point. It is a physical attribute of matter. This transition takes place when the attraction interactions between the substance's molecules outweigh their kinetic energy, leading the molecules to organise themselves in a predictable way and create a solid lattice. The nature of the substance, pressure, and contaminants in the substance are some of the elements that affect the freezing point. Different intermolecular forces of varying types and strengths give different substances different freezing points. Thefreezing pointof lead is 621.5 fahrenheit (327.5 celsius).

The environment plays a crucial role in an organism's ability to fossilize. Which is the best location for fossilization?A) bottom of a river
B) very dry environments, such as land
C) bottom of a lake covered by sediment
Eliminate
D) an environment exposed to natural elements

Answers

The answer is C. The process of fossilization is dependent on the environment. It plays an essential role for the process to occur. The best location possible would be in a bottom of a lake where the organism is buried and is covered with a lot of sediment.
